Announcements are the custom pop-ups designed to announce any new feature, version release or to provide information to the End Users. An Announcement can be built with Custom buttons that can launch a Workflow, Video or a Document. Announcements enable the admin to make announcements to the user when they go to the specific page. The Announcement can be for specified period and (or) when certain UI conditions are matched.
|Reference: What is an Announcement?|
This instructions set explains the procedure of creating Launchers and includes 3 steps:
- Accessing Announcements option in the Apty Studio,
- Creating an Announcement, and
- Publishing a Frame with an Announcement.
2. Click on the Announcements icon.
3. The system will prompt you to create a Frame, unless it was created earlier. If the required Frame for this page was created earlier, select it from the list.
To learn how to create a Frame, refer to this article.
To create an Announcement:
NOTE: As you are customizing the content and functionality of an Announcement, you can preview it live in the browser area to have an exact idea of how it is going to look to the end users.
3. Define an expected Announcement Action. An Announcement has the capability to:
- be accepted,
- start a Workflow,
- launch a Video, and/or
- Select a Sample Announcement icon from the LAUNCHER OPTIONS.
- Define the label of the acceptance button that clearly stats that the user read and acknowledged the information in the Announcement.
- Select a Workflow icon from the LAUNCHER OPTIONS.
- Select the Workflow from the Select Workflow drop-down list. Only the Workflows assigned to the same page are displayed at the drop-down list. To create a new Workflow refer to this article.
- Select the step from which the Workflow should launch from the Select Step drop-down list.
- Select a Video icon from the LAUNCHER OPTIONS.
- You need to upload the video to the Knowledge Store to be able to see it in the drop-down. If it has not been added, click Add new Content and add a name to be displayed and URL to the web page where it is stored. It will automatically get added to the Knowledge Store.
- Select a URL icon from the LAUNCHER OPTIONS.
- You need to add the Link in the Knowledge Store to be able to see it in the drop-down.If it has not been added, click Add new Content and add a name to be displayed and URL to the web page where it is stored. It will automatically get added to the Knowledge Store.
5. Announcement is Mandatory:
The acceptance of Announcement by the user becomes mandatory and is going to be used as a part of data tracked for Announcements Analytics. The text label may be changed in the CHECKBOX LABEL field.
Apty offers 12 predefined positions to locate the Announcement on the canvas of a browser application. Click the position to preview the Announcement position in the live mode.
- Element Presence,
- Label Comparison,
- Spotlight Comparison,
- Custom Script.
Each of the options is described below.
When Element presence is selected, the Announcement display is determined by the presence or absence of a selected Element.
To define the element of the hosting application which should determine the display of the Announcement, select Element Presence from the Conditions drop-down list. The control is now passed to the browser window to click on the element of the hosting application to define its significance.
- The element selected can be changed by Re-selecting element.
- Multiple conditions of Element Presence type can be added.
Label Comparison is an alternative to the Element Presence but on top of checking the presence of an element it also compares the value in the element. If the value provided while creating an Announcement matches / not matches with the value selected by the end user, the Announcement appears.
- To set up Label Comparison, click Select Label. The control is now passed to the browser window to define the element, the input for which is going to be tested.
- Access comparison criteria from the drop-down list: Equal, NotEqual, Regex, Contains, EmptyValue, NotEmptyValue.
- Define the relation between the Label and value based on the defined comparison criterion.
NOTE: Multiple Label Comparisons can be done at a time.
Spotlight comparison follows the same logic as Label Comparison and can be applied to any editable fields with values as opposed to Labels.
The appearance of Announcement can be controlled based on the script that can be customized as required.
comes into play for advanced condition control.
NOTE: This display option may be combined with other Conditions specified above.
9. Click Save to start using a new Announcement. It is now available as a part of a Frame in the Admin Console, but to make it active, the Frame should be published.
To publish a Frame with an Announcement:
When the Announcements are added to the Frame and are ready to be used, system still preserves Frame in the Draft status, unless stated otherwise.
To change the Frame status to Ready or Publish:
When all the Tooltips are added to the required Spotlights in a Frame and are ready to be used, system still preserves them in the Draft status, unless stated otherwise.
To change the Frame status to Ready or Publish:
PATH: Admin Console > on the left side panel select an application you've worked at in the Apty Studio > Publish > Frames
- Draft: This state specifies that the content is in the development state and is not ready for testing or being available for end users.
- Ready: This state defines that the instructional content is ready for testing in the development or test environment. In this state the content can be seen in the Apty Studio only in the development environment but is not available in the production environment.
- Publish: This state specifies that the content has been tested and is ready to be available for the hosting application end users. The content in this state will be visible in the Apty Studio to the production environment.
Once the Frame is published, Announcements cannot be modified. In order to modify the Announcements, change the status of the Frame to the Draft state.